Frequently Asked Questions

How much do Legislators make in Oklahoma?
Legislators in Oklahoma earn a median annual salary of $48,294 per year ($23.22/hr) according to BLS OEWS data (May 2024). This is below the national median of $55,510.
Is Oklahoma a good state for Legislators?
Oklahoma pays slightly below the national average for legislators. Cost of living in Oklahoma is lower average (COL index: 90.4).
What is the cost-of-living adjusted salary for Legislators in Oklahoma?
After adjusting for cost of living (COL index: 90.4 vs. Missouri baseline of 100), the $48,294 salary in Oklahoma has the purchasing power of approximately $53,423 in Missouri. Lower living costs in Oklahoma increase real purchasing power.
